When selecting backhoe cylinders, attention to detail is crucial. These components must withstand heavy usage and harsh conditions. Evaluate the material used in construction. High-strength steel can often resist wear better than lighter alternatives. Think about the cylinder's specifications. Stroke length and bore size directly impact performance.
The seal design is another key feature. Quality seals enhance durability and minimize leaks. Pay close attention to the operating pressures. Ensure the cylinders can handle the machine's demands effectively. Match the operating environment as well. Consider factors like temperature extremes and exposure to contaminants.

When evaluating backhoe cylinder options, material durability stands out as a crucial factor. Various materials are used in manufacturing cylinders, each offering unique advantages and drawbacks.
Steel, for instance, is commonly favored for its strength. However, it can be prone to rust if not properly treated. Aluminum cylinders are lighter, improving mobility.
Yet, they may not withstand heavy loads as well as steel.
Performance is another vital aspect. A backhoe cylinder's effectiveness relies on its ability to maintain pressure and efficiency over time. Hydraulic seals play a key role here. High-quality seals minimize leakage and improve overall function.
However, regular wear and tear can occur, leading to decreased performance. Buyers must regularly assess their equipment to prevent unexpected failures.
